CAMP SITE The campsite is located on a lot nestled in trees approximately 1 hour from Toronto. LAKE Canal Lake is a lake of Ontario, Canada, situated in the City of Kawartha Lakes. HISTORIC MONUMENTS The "Hole in the Wall" bridge was built in 1905 and is also known as the Canal Lake Concrete Arch Bridge. It was designed by the federal Department of Railways and Canals. It is located on Centennial Park Road on the southwest side of the Trent Severn Waterway bridge, northeast of Bolsover. The bridge was designated a National Historic Site of Canada in 1988. FISHING Canal Lake is a medium size lake with a large diversity of fishing spots. There is a variety of fish available including largemouth bass, pike and muskellunge (muskie) and an abundance of panfish.
